Timothy Coggins, 23, was found stabbed to death on October 9, 1983 in a town about 30 miles south of Atlanta. Witnesses say the suspects allegedly bragged about the crime for years. They were angry...

Franklin Gebhardt, 60, was sentenced to life in prison plus an additional 20 years this week for the brutal murder of Timothy Coggins. On Oct. 9, 1983, 23-year-old Coggins was found stabbed to ...Timothy Coggins, 23, was the victim of a racial motivated murder in rural Georgia in 1983. His murderers were brought to justice in 2018 after a cold case investigator revisited the case. Coggins was found dead along a road in the city of Sunny Side on Oct. 9, 1983.Reader discretion is advised. Timothy Coggins, a Black man from Griffin, Georgia, was found murdered on October 9, 1983. His body was left under a giant oak, known locally as “ the Hanging Tree .”. He’d been dragged behind a vehicle and then stabbed. “X” marks were carved into his torso to represent a Confederate flag.Listen Now.
